From 2c2e1ade7ce90e731ab9645eed3546db1e4ed6f3 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: hauke Date: Mon, 8 Mar 2010 22:03:00 +0000 Subject: brcm47xx: fix commit r18413 "128MB ram problem" The patch commited in r18413 was wrong. This patch prevents prom_init_mem from scanning over 128MB ram.
